C.J.C Edwards is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Spectroscopy and Civil and Structural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, C.J.C Edwards has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 413 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 5 papers in Spectroscopy and 4 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ering. Recurrent topics in C.J.C Edwards's work include Asphalt Pavement Performance Evaluation (4 papers), Adsorption, diffusion, and thermodynamic properties of materials (3 papers) and Polymer crystallization and properties (3 papers). C.J.C Edwards is often cited by papers focused on Asphalt Pavement Performance Evaluation (4 papers), Adsorption, diffusion, and thermodynamic properties of materials (3 papers) and Polymer crystallization and properties (3 papers). C.J.C Edwards coll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Germany and Czechia. C.J.C Edwards's co-authors include R. F. T. Stepto, D St P Bunbury, J.A. Semlyen, David L. Rigby, K. Dodgson, H. E. Hall, Randal W. Richards, J. A. Hockey, J. S. Higgins and Walther Burchard and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Macromolecules and Polymer.
